> The "missing" invalid key error for WEP has nothing to do with WEP not
> implementing 4 way handshake. WEP protocol is specified such that there
> is no indication of a wrong key.
>
> The approximately only way of detecting an invalid WEP key is to notice
> that traffic for this SSID cannot be decrypted. If this persists for
> some time, it is very likely that the WEP passphrase is incorrect.

> Userconnect set to false simply means ConnMan is autoconnecting by
> itself and no input is ever asked from an Agent. Should some input be
> needed with userconnect set to false, the service is set into an
> appropriate error state instead.
>
> So this change nukes our only knowledge of the connection being
> requested by an external entity, i.e. a user.
